主题
Agent框架集锦
AutoGPT
基于OpenAI LLM的自定义AI代理工具包,功能强大,GitHub上受欢迎。https://github.com/Significant-Gravitas/AutoGPT
BabyAGI
任务驱动型智能体,代码简洁,可扩展性强,支持多种平台和插件。
https://github.com/yoheinakajima/babyagi
SuperAGI
灵活的开源AI智能体框架,支持多模型、GUI、矢量数据库集成和性能洞察。
https://github.com/TransformerOptimus/SuperAGI
ShortGPT
专注于视频内容创作,可生成脚本、画外音、音乐、标题等。
https://github.com/RayVentura/ShortGPT
ChatDev
虚拟软件公司框架,多智能体协作完成软件开发任务。
https://github.com/OpenBMB/ChatDev
AutoGen
微软开源框架,支持多智能体协同工作,简化智能体通信。
https://github.com/microsoft/autogen
MetaGPT
模仿软件公司结构,智能体分配角色协作完成编码任务。
https://github.com/geekan/MetaGPT
Camel
多智能体框架,基于角色扮演设计,动态分配任务,促进智能体协作。
https://github.com/camel-ai/camel
LoopGPT
AutoGPT迭代版本,支持GPT-3.5,改进集成和自定义功能,成本低。
https://github.com/farizrahman4u/loopgpt
JARVIS
使用ChatGPT作为决策引擎,结合HuggingFace模型,灵活处理多种任务。
https://github.com/microsoft/JARVIS
OpenAGI
开源AGI研究平台,结合专家模型和任务反馈强化学习,动态选择工具。
https://github.com/agiresearch/OpenAGI
LangChain
强大的工作流自动化框架,支持复杂任务的模块化构建和多LLM集成。
https://github.com/langchain-ai/langchain
LangGraph
基于图的工作流框架,适合复杂任务的有状态管理和顺序执行。
https://github.com/langchain-ai/langgraph
CrewAI
角色驱动的协作框架,支持快速原型开发,适合轻量级团队协作任务。
https://github.com/crewAIInc/crewAI
Microsoft Semantic Kernel
企业级框架,集成知识图谱和多模态记忆,适合跨系统决策。
https://github.com/microsoft/semantic-kernel
OpenAI Swarm
基于蜂群理念的框架,支持高度灵活的交互模式,适合快速验证项目。
https://github.com/openai/swarm
Magentic-One
预装多种专用Agent,开箱即用性强,适合标准化任务
https://github.com/jackmpcollins/magentic
Archon
开源框架,支持智能体自主构建、多智能体协作和领域知识集成。
https://github.com/coleam00/Archon
OmAgent
创新性框架,支持多模态输入输出,适合复杂任务处理和多模态应用。